Understanding ABV and flavor differences in keystone beer
You should check ABV percentage when you're deciding between lighter and fuller options. ABV tells you how strong the beer is, so your choice feels more aligned with your occasion.
If you want a smoother, lighter profile, you may lean toward a 4.1% ABV light lager. If you want a stronger presence, you may choose a 5.9% ABV ice beer.
You can pair flavor with food and timing, which makes selection easier. You'll often enjoy lighter lagers with burgers, snacks, and daytime gatherings, while fuller styles fit later events.
